Transaction 5829662330ac0057ec86e95249acd7d86871748a7437bdc4fc2420c985fe53af

1 Input
2 Outputs
  • 5829662330ac0057ec86e95249acd7d86871748a7437bdc4fc2420c985fe53af:0
  • value  589777
    address  14L4yUE2N82fHdkAC2cJCjy5jNtMH3vS5s
  • 5829662330ac0057ec86e95249acd7d86871748a7437bdc4fc2420c985fe53af:1
  • value  16292497
    address  1KXucFdvdrKkSEUoQvkJRhG2jH56wWoaFx